We are SGS - the world's leading testing, inspection, and certification company. We are recognized as the global benchmark for quality and integrity.

Our 96,000 employees operate a network of 2,600 offices and laboratories, working together to enable a better, safer, and more interconnected world.

In Canada, SGS employs over 2,000 team members across 70 locations.


Job Description:


Type of employment:
Permanent


Reporting to:
Laboratory Supervisor

  • Perform a variety of decomposition and leaching methods as per SGS' Standard Operating Procedures (SOP). These will include acid digests, selective leaches, fusions and others as required
  • Make basic reagents as necessary
  • Provides feedback to supervisors and/or group leader regarding any issues encountered during procedures. E.g. unanticipated reactions, loss of samples
  • Verify and adjust calibrations on a variety of lab equipment including dispensers, pipettes, balances and other.
  • Ensure that work order documentation is complete in every respect and QC results are entered into SLIMS as necessary.
  • Maintain clean and organized workbench area ensuring spills are immediately cleaned; disposal is handled according to laboratory procedures including any special requirements for handling international soils.
  • Clean labware as required
  • Ensure that equipment's are maintained in good order making the supervisor or group leader aware of any damaged or defective equipment or any equipment requiring complex adjustment.
  • Notify supervisor when consumables are nearing depletion to ensure they are reordered
  • Keep all records and notebooks in good order including work order and equipment maintenance logs.
  • Adhere to assigned working hours unless otherwise approved by the Supervisor
  • May be asked to work in other areas of the Geochemistry laboratory sections when required.
